In this episode of The CTO Show with Mehmet, we sit down with Michael Cutajar, CEO of AI Partners, who’s on a mission to fix the broken world of accounting through the power of AI agents. From his early days as a PwC accountant in Malta to founding multiple startups—including a VR venture and now an AI-driven automation company—Michael shares what it takes to go from employee to entrepreneur, how to close six-figure enterprise deals, and why cultural resistance to failure is holding regions like Europe and MENA back.🎯 What You’ll Learn • Why the accounting industry is broken—and how AI agents can fix it • How to sell automation without triggering fear of job loss • Michael’s approach to closing large deals through trust and patience • Why he traveled to Silicon Valley to build founder confidence • How to reframe failure as feedback • The hidden importance of storytelling in tech entrepreneurship • Why personal touch still matters in a world of AI⸻🧠 Key Takeaways • “Build for free to earn trust” can break through even the most skeptical industries • Defensibility in AI isn’t just about code—it’s about context, geography, and relationships • Europe’s fear of failure is cultural, not intellectual—founders need a new narrative • The future of junior roles in accounting (and tech) is advisory, not operational👤 About the GuestMichael Cutajar is the founder and CEO of AI Partners, a startup creating AI agents tailored for finance and accounting workflows.
